    9、 October 2011 Page 2 of 3 3.2 Material and Performance Requirements. Material and performance requirements are summarized in Table 1.Table 1: Material and Performance Properties Property Test Method Unit Value Hardness Type A ISO 7619-1 Shore A As specified on drawing Type B As specified on drawing/

    10、math data file Shore A As specified on drawing Elongation at Break Type A ISO 37, Type 4 dumb-bell, 200 20 mm/minute % 250 minimum Type B As specified on drawing/math data file % As specified on drawing Age Resistance (Heat Aging) Type A ISO 188 Method B,72 -2 h at +100 3 C Change in Hardness Shore

    11、A 5 maximum Type B As specified on drawing/math data file As specified on drawing Compression Set Type A ISO 815 test piece Type B +70 3 C, 24 -2 h, 25% compressed % 25 maximum Type B As specified on drawing/math data file % As specified on drawing Ozone Resistance Type A ISO 1431-1, 50 pphm, 25 2 C

    12、, 20% strain, 72 -2 h visual examination No cracks permissible Type B As specified on drawing/math data file As specified on drawing Cold Resistance Type A ISO 23529, -30 3 C; 5 +1 h Bending test r=2,5 mm No cracks Type B As specified on drawing/math data file MPa As specified on drawing Abrasion Re

    13、sistance Type A GMW3283-3 on complete part but 10 1 N load, 500 cycles cm As specified on drawing Type B As specified on drawing/math data file As specified on drawing 4 Manufacturing Process Not Applicable. 5 Rules and Regulations 5.1 Legal Regulations.
